Eat Out to Help Out Indie York Directory

Restaurants and other food outlets have signed up to the Eat Out to Help Out scheme which will offer 50% off the bill (excluding alcohol), up to a maximum of £10 per person, throughout August. It’s available from 3rd August 2020 - Monday to Wednesday only. The scheme is designed to help the UK's many food businesses. The floods - York is open for business

For many in York last year, Christmas was cut short when the floods of Boxing Day arrived. The city’s plight, along with many other areas around the country, was well documented by the media but it was also giving the impression that the entire city was underwater and a complete no-go zone

The map and Indie York

With the campaign set in motion by the 30 initial businesses, the aim was to turn this negative news of the floods into a positive.
